Description

NU-MAG is a patented, certified organic rice extract blend designed as a clean-label alternative to conventional magnesium stearate, widely utilized in the nutraceutical and pharmaceutical industries. Sourced from sustainable rice, this innovative excipient functions primarily as a lubricant and anti-caking agent, optimizing manufacturing processes by ensuring smooth powder flow and preventing ingredients from sticking to machinery during encapsulation or tableting. Its unique composition, often comprising rice bran extract, rice hull powder, and gum arabic, provides superior lubrication without the use of chemical solvents or synthetic additives. This makes NU-MAG an ideal choice for brands seeking to enhance product quality and consumer trust through transparent, natural ingredient declarations, aligning with the growing demand for "free-from" and organic product formulations. The material's fine particle size and low moisture content contribute to its efficacy in various dry blend applications.

While NU-MAG itself is primarily an excipient and does not confer direct health benefits in the way an active ingredient would, its mechanism of action is crucial for maintaining the integrity and efficacy of the final supplement product. By facilitating uniform powder flow, NU-MAG ensures consistent dosing of active ingredients, thereby supporting the intended health outcomes. Its role in preventing compression issues and maintaining tablet hardness or capsule integrity indirectly contributes to product stability and bioavailability. Research into excipient functionality, such as a study published in the *Journal of Pharmaceutical Sciences*, highlights how proper lubrication prevents active ingredient degradation during processing and ensures accurate release profiles. The natural compounds within rice extract, such as tocopherols and tocotrienols from rice bran, also contribute minor antioxidant properties, though these are not the primary function or benefit of NU-MAG in a formulation. The blend's natural origin minimizes concerns associated with synthetic excipients.

NU-MAG is extensively applied across various supplement formulations, including capsules, tablets, and powdered drink mixes, where it serves to improve blend uniformity and manufacturing efficiency. Its suitability for certified organic products makes it a preferred choice for formulators adhering to strict organic standards, avoiding the use of non-organic processing aids. Quality considerations for NU-MAG include ensuring its non-GMO status, purity, and consistent particle size distribution, which are critical for predictable performance in high-speed manufacturing environments.
